Lactonamycin

Class: Natural product antibiotic (naphthoquinone)

Spectrum of activity: Gram-positive
Details of activity: Active against methicillin-resistant and -susceptible Staphylococcus aureus, Streptococcus faecalis, Streptococcus pyogenes, Corynebacterium bovis,Enterococcus faecium, and Enterococcus faecalis
Description: Natural product from Streptomyces rishiriensis; also shows anti-tumour properties
Year first mentioned: 1999
Development status: Experimental
